Patent number: 8690474Abstract: A control and switchover system is provided for controlling milling depth and/or slope of a milling drum of a road construction machine during a milling operation to create a milled surface. The system controls the milling depth and/or slope at least in part on a measurement made with a first sensor. Without interrupting the milling operation the system switches over the control of the milling depth and/or slope to control based at least in part on a measurement made with a second sensor.Type: GrantFiled: July 3, 2013Date of Patent: April 8, 2014Assignee: Wirtgen GmbHInventors: Jaroslaw Jurasz, Günter Hähn, Günter Tewes

Patent number: 8113592Abstract: A road construction machine includes a machine frame, a working drum and a plurality of ground engaging supports. A plurality of lifting columns are connected between the machine frame and the ground engaging supports. Each of the lifting columns include two telescoping hollow cylinders. A plurality of lifting position measuring devices are provided, each measuring device being coupled with elements of one of the lifting columns, which elements are capable of being displaced relative to one another in accordance with the lifting position of the lifting column in such a manner that a path signal pertaining to a lifting position of the lifting column is continuously detectable by the measuring device. A controller is operably connected to the lifting position measuring devices to receive the path signals and to regulate the lifting positions of the lifting columns in response to the path signals.Type: GrantFiled: September 12, 2006Date of Patent: February 14, 2012Assignee: Wirtgen GmbHInventors: Peter Busley, Günter Tewes

Patent number: 7597402Abstract: A tool holder including a tool box with a tool seat in a holding projection for receiving a tool in such a manner that it can be replaced. The tool seat is configured as a bore and has a tool insertion opening. The tool holder has a fastening side with a fastening projection and, facing away from said fastening side, an exterior, and during use of the tool centrifugal forces are effective in the direction from the fastening side to the exterior. This invention ensures the free rotatability of a tool inserted in the tool holder even if overburden material enters the tool seat. For this purpose, the holding projection has an opening penetrating the inner wall of the tool seat and creating a spatial connection to the exterior, and the opening opens the tool seat towards the exterior.Type: GrantFiled: April 16, 2005Date of Patent: October 6, 2009Assignee: Wirtgen GmbHInventors: Günter Tewes, Jochen Blens, Bernd Holl

Patent number: 7461903Abstract: A cutting tool of a cutting machine having a base part and a bit holder. According to this invention, the bit holder has a plug-in attachment, retained in a socket of the base part that has a stop against which the bit holder rests. To prevent the penetration of water and stone dust and to allow the bit holder to be easily detached from the base part, a sealing element is located between the bit holder and the base part, surrounding at least sections of the socket.Type: GrantFiled: October 11, 2003Date of Patent: December 9, 2008Assignee: Wirtgen GmbHInventors: Günter Tewes, Bernd Holl
